2016-09-15 3 views
0

In Powershell Ich tippe:Wie zeigen/erhalten Sie eine Verknüpfung/Verknüpfung in PowerShell?

PS C:\Users\user01\Desktop> ls -force 

Diese 8 Dateien zeigt, aber 2 versteckt sind (Modus: -a-hs). Der Befehl sagt mir, dass ich 6 Dateien habe.

Aber wenn ich auf den Desktop schaue, sehe ich 9 Dateien. Ich weiß, dass 3 von ihnen Verknüpfungen/Verknüpfungen (einschließlich Papierkorb) sind.

Wie kann ich PowersSell zeigen alle Dateien/Verknüpfungen? Oder ist ein Link/Verknüpfung nicht eine Datei/ein Element?

+0

try -include * .lnk – Jimbo

+0

Problem. Wie unterscheiden sich die Links von den Anwendungsdateien? –

+0

funktioniert für mich in der Powershell ISE - läuft als Administrator – Jimbo

Antwort

0

Hier Skript Rückkehr Shell FolderItem Objekte für alle Elemente auf dem Desktop:

$shell = new-object -com shell.application 
$desktop = $shell.Namespace(0) 
$desktop.Items() 
+0

Es werden alle Shell-Objekte angezeigt, unabhängig davon, ob sie angezeigt werden oder nicht. –

Verwandte Themen